Web2 apr. 2024 · Objective: Violent and aggressive behaviors are common among psychiatric inpatients. Hospital security officers are sometimes used to address such behaviors. Research on the role of security in inpatient units is scant. This study examined when security is utilized and what happens when officers arrive. Web5 apr. 2024 · Lisbon specifically sees 4.5 million tourists a year – for every resident, there are 9 tourists. The government wants to focus on the positives of tourism so protecting tourists to Lisbon is a priority. There is a high level of police presence and a corresponding very low level of crimes against tourists.
